A custom [command] code
 
I was just thinking about this when i released one of my hacks. What about having a custom BB code or command like [install], and when that is called in a thread it will show the install button of that style. I noticed there isn't a way to show the correct install button when the user is viewing the thread. Just thought it would be a good idea. :) I'm sure the built in replacements feature would come handy for this.
